Understanding No-Code Development
No-code development refers to the process of building applications using graphical user interfaces and configuration instead of traditional programming. This approach allows users to design and deploy applications quickly, making it accessible for non-technical individuals and empowering teams to innovate faster.

Popular No-Code Platforms
There are numerous no-code platforms available today, each catering to different needs. Here are some of the most popular options:
| Platform | Main Features | Best For |
|---|---|---|
| Bubble | Visual web app builder, responsive design, database integration | Custom web applications |
| Adalo | Mobile app development, drag-and-drop interface, component library | Mobile applications |
| Airtable | Spreadsheet-database hybrid, project management features, templates | Data organization and management |
| Zapier | Workflow automation, app integrations, multi-step workflows | Connecting different software tools |
| Webflow | Website design, CMS capabilities, e-commerce functionality | Web design and development |
Step-by-Step Guide to Building an App with No-Code Tools
Building an app with no-code tools can be broken down into several key steps. Follow this guide to turn your idea into a reality:
Step 1: Define Your Idea
Start by clearly defining the purpose of your app. Consider the following questions:
- What problem does your app solve?
- Who is your target audience?
- What features are essential for your MVP (Minimum Viable Product)?
Step 2: Choose the Right No-Code Platform
Select a no-code platform that aligns with your app’s requirements. Evaluate platforms based on:
- Functionality
- User interface and user experience (UI/UX)
- Integration possibilities
- Budget and pricing structure
Step 3: Design the User Interface
The design is crucial for user engagement. Utilize the platform’s drag-and-drop features to:
- Create wireframes of your app’s pages
- Add interactive elements such as buttons, forms, and images
- Ensure a consistent look and feel across all screens
Step 4: Set Up the Backend
Even with no-code tools, some backend functionality is necessary. Depending on the platform, set up:
- Databases to store user information and app data
- APIs for connecting with external services
- User authentication and role management
Step 5: Test Your App
Before launching, perform thorough testing to ensure everything works as intended. Consider the following:
- Test all functionalities
- Gather feedback from potential users
- Fix any bugs or issues
Step 6: Launch Your App
Once testing is complete, it’s time to launch! Promote your app through various channels:
- Social media
- Email newsletters
- Online communities relevant to your app
